padding_mode (str): Type of padding. Should be: constant, edge, reflect or symmetric.
Default is constant.
- constant: pads with a constant value, this value is specified with fill
- edge: pads with the last value at the edge of the image
- reflect: pads with reflection of image without repeating the last value on the edge
For example, padding [1, 2, 3, 4] with 2 elements on both sides in reflect mode
will result in [3, 2, 1, 2, 3, 4, 3, 2]
